Bayern Munich 1-3 Liverpool: Sadio Mane and Van Dijk sends Liverpool to Quarter Finals

Liverpool have won 3-1 at the Allianz Arena to book their place in the Champions League quarter-finals.

Jurgen Klopp's men took the lead thanks to a brilliant goal from Sadio Mane, the man in form for the Reds.

During a cagey first-half, the Senegalese forward latched on to a ball from the Liverpool defence and completely deceived Manual Neuer as he sprinted out from goal.

Showing shades of Raheem Sterling against Manchester City in 2014, he delivered a fine left-footed chip into the open net.

However, the Bayern response came just minutes later, with Serge Gnabry causing damage on the right flank and firing across goal.

Joel Matip was the unlucky party to make contact, prodding the ball past Alisson Becker and giving the Bavarians hope of turning things around.

Nevertheless, the away-goal rule ensured that Bayern needed to double their advantage and they put the visitors under immense pressure after the break.

Klopp was becoming increasingly frustrated with his midfield - to which Fabinho had been added early on - but the Reds' defence stood resolute.

And it was Virgil van Dijk who eventually provided the breathing space that Liverpool needed, rising highest from a corner to head home.

It marked the 27-year-old's third goal of the season and none have been more important, necessitating than extra two goals from their German hosts.

Then Mane bagged a headed goal of his own to put the game to bed, his third in eight matches in Europe - prompting a mass exodus of Bayern fans.
